Description
In a narrative that delves into the depths of faith and personal struggle, the story seeks to explore a pivotal moment in time—when Simon Peter stood between the crucified Savior and the tumultuous sea. The author guides readers through Peter's turmoil, painting a vivid picture of his internal conflict and the significant choices he faced at such a harrowing juncture. The crossroads of doubt and belief become a central theme, as Peter grapples with his loyalty to Christ amidst the chaos of the world around him.
This retelling not only reconstructs a well-known biblical episode but also humanizes one of Christianity's most beloved figures. It invites readers to reflect on the nature of faith and the challenges that can arise when the weight of the world seems overwhelming. Through Peter's lens, the story resonates on a personal level, inviting a deeper understanding of the trials of discipleship and the profound journey between faith and doubt.
